The Role of Ireland in Global Health Initiatives and Pandemic Response

Ireland has played a significant role in global health initiatives and pandemic response efforts over the past few decades. Its contributions range from financial support to active participation in international organizations dedicated to health and disease prevention.

Historical Background of Ireland’s Involvement

Since the late 20th century, Ireland has increased its engagement in global health. Initially focusing on development aid, the country gradually expanded its role to include active participation in global health governance and emergency response efforts.

Financial Contributions

Ireland contributes financially to major health initiatives such as the World Health Organization (WHO), Gavi, the Vaccine Alliance, and the Global Fund. These contributions help fund vaccination programs, disease eradication efforts, and health system strengthening in developing countries.

Participation in International Organizations

Irish representatives actively participate in international health organizations, providing expertise and leadership. Ireland’s involvement ensures that global health policies consider the needs of both developed and developing nations.

Ireland’s Role During Pandemics

During recent pandemics, such as COVID-19, Ireland responded swiftly by implementing public health measures, supporting vaccine distribution, and aiding international relief efforts. The country also collaborated with the European Union and WHO to coordinate responses and share resources.

Domestic Response and Support

Within Ireland, the government prioritized testing, contact tracing, and vaccination campaigns. Public health campaigns promoted awareness and compliance with safety measures, helping to control the spread of the virus.

International Aid and Collaboration

Ireland provided financial aid and medical supplies to countries with weaker health systems. Irish health professionals also volunteered in international efforts to combat COVID-19, sharing expertise and resources globally.

Future Outlook

Looking ahead, Ireland aims to strengthen its role in global health by increasing funding, participating in innovative health research, and fostering international partnerships. The country recognizes that global health security depends on collaborative efforts and shared responsibility.
